Using natural language like rules to define condition and validator
The rule syntax is like natural language. It has both readability for non-developers and expressiveness for complex workflow logic.
The editor provides controlled editing experience. With its syntax coloring and code completion assistance, it is easy to create and update your rule logic.
Managing post-function is easy by using conditional action in the form of if-then-else rule.

Installation
- Log into your Jira instance as an admin.
- Click the admin dropdown and choose Add-ons. The Manage add-ons screen loads.
- Click Find new apps or Find new add-ons from the left-hand side of the page.
- Locate Workflow Rules Lite via search. Results include app versions compatible with your Jira instance.
- Click Install to download and install your app.
- You're all set! Click Close in the Installed and ready to go dialog.
To find older Workflow Rules Lite versions compatible with your instance, you can look through our version history page.
